Dors 820 User Manual v3.0

The document is a user manual for the DORS 820 banknote counter. It has two pockets, recognizes currency value and authenticity, and can sort notes by orientation, denomination, and fitness level. Key features include an 800-note hopper capacity, 200-note stacker capacity, 100-note reject pocket, and counting speeds from 600-1500 notes per minute. It uses sensors and patented validation systems to analyze banknotes and has settings that can be configured for various counting modes and operations.

1 «Common» Submenu (see Fig.17)
Contains the categories «Detection», «Count rate», «Add», Fig. 17
and the keys «Info», «Pocket limits», «Print», «Addit.»
Detection
Each counting mode has own range of available detection.
In COUNT mode the transmissive UV control (UV-T) and the optical density
control of banknotes (DENSITY) are available.
In DEN and MIX modes the available kinds of detection are: the reflective
UV control (UV-R), magnetic marks control (MG), strict level of counterfeit
detection (STRICT).
UV-T and UV-R are respectively translucent and reflective ultraviolet
detection mode. When it's activated ( , ), and a banknote with
an increased UV fluorescence has been found (for example, a counterfeit Count rate
printed on plain paper), the banknote goes to the reject pocket (the reasons of The user can choose any of four counting rates (600, 900 (1000), 1200, or
rejection are available in the «REPORT» submenu). 1500 banknotes per minute). The check-box against the selected speed is
UV-T is translucent UV control. When is on, the banknotes with highlighted in blue. For counting of worn notes we suggest lower speed (600 or
increased UV-luminescence (for instance, counterfeit notes printed on regular 900 notes/min).
paper) will be redirected to reject pocket (reject reason is available in REPORT Warning: When S/N or Fitness mode is on, only two counting speeds (600
menu). and 1000 notes/min) are available.

SN Trust Level SN parameters menu


SN trust level is the parameter that sets where to redirect the banknote Touch (Fig. 61) to open SN parameters menu.
according to the results of SN detection. SN trust level detected by the WARNING: SN parameters menu is password5 protected. Enter valid
counter may be within – 5 … 65 (refer to Table 2). password to open the menu: touch grey rectangle (Fig. 68) to display the
TABLE 2 keyboard (Fig. 69), type the password and touch to open SN parameters
menu (Fig. 70).
Trust Level Description
Fig. 68
65 All SN symbols detected. No SN symbol discrepancy
found.
64 1 symbol is not detected. However full result line has
been achieved based on all banknote SNs data. No SN
symbol discrepancy found.
63 2 symbols are not detected. However full result line has
been achieved based on all banknote SNs data. No SN
symbol discrepancy found.
62 3 symbols are not detected. However full result line has
been achieved based on all banknote SNs data.
No SN symbol discrepancy found. Fig. 69
32 Some symbols are not detected. However result line
has been achieved based on all banknote SNs data
except 1 symbol. (_) will be displayed in the result line
instead of missing symbol.
No SN symbol discrepancy found.
31 Some symbols are not detected. However result line
has been achieved based on all banknote SNs data
except 2 symbols. (_) will be displayed in the result line
instead of missing symbols.
No SN symbol discrepancy found.
30 Some symbols are not detected. However result line
has been achieved based on all banknote SNs data
except 3 symbols. (_) will be displayed in the result line Fig. 70
instead of missing symbols.
No SN symbol discrepancy found.

0 SN detection hasn't been done.


-1 Banknote SNs do not match each other. (!) will be
displayed in the result line instead of mismatching
symbols.
-2 SN doesn't match the formula preset for the detected
currency.
-3 Missing characters, SN is probably in the black list Selected currency, denomination and issue are displayed in the upper part
of the screen. If any of the above is not selected (Fig. 70), then trust level
-4 SN processing is incomplete. setting is unavailable (Fig. 74).
-5 SN matches the data in the black list 5

TRANSPORTATION AND STORAGE FIRMWARE UPDATE


The machine in the original package can be shipped by sea (in containers), Among the advantages of DORS 820 there is the remote way of firmware
by railway (in closed carriage), by air (in the pressurized modules) and by (FW) update via Internet. If a customer has Internet connection, there is no
cargo (in covered truck or in container with water-resistant top) along the need to call technician for the update. Your machine will be updated with new
paved roads. Transportation conditions: temperature from - 30 to + 50°C, counterfeit and authentic notes detection as well as with other improvements
relative humidity up to 98% without water condensation at 25°C and automatically. We recommend checking for new update every two weeks.
atmosphere pressure 84 to 107 kPa (630 to 800 mm Hg). The computer, to which the counter would be connected for firmware
The machine in the original package can be stored in a heated and ventilated update, should match the following requirements:
warehouse, at the temperature of +5°C to +40°C and relative humidity not – OS WinXP or higher;
exceeding 80% at +25°C. A warehouse should be free of the aggressive – Display resolution 800x600 or higher;
agents (acid and alkali vapours) that might cause corrosion. – Internet connection;
